Electrical Intermediate Level DesignerAt Jacobs, we're challenging today to reinvent tomorrow by solving the world's most critical problems for thriving cities, resilient environments, mission-critical outcomes, operational advancement, scientific discovery and cutting-edge manufacturing, turning abstract ideas into realities that transform the world for good.We're seeking an Electrical Intermediate Level Designer to join our Tool Installation team. This challenging position involves working as part of a multi-discipline, highly interactive and coordinated team focused on projects primarily for the semiconductor manufacturing industry.Bring your curiosity, talent for multi-tasking and collaboration, and extreme organizational skills and we'll help you grow, pursue and fulfill what drives you – so we can make big impacts on the world, together.What you'll do:Utilize AutoCADPrepare drawings using computer aided drafting and basic design of electrical power, life safety, and telecommunications services to manufacturing tools, using appropriate design criteria.Coordinate directly with engineers and package design leads to balance workload and deliver packages, often under tight deadlines.Here's what you'll need:High school graduate or equivalent2+ years experience with AutoCADProficiency in electrical design and layout requirements. Including items such as one-line diagrams, riser diagrams, electrical plan view drawingsProficiency with Microsoft Office Suite, including Word, Excel and Outlook.Strong communication, organization and self-performance skillsAbility to collaborate and work effectively in a variety of situations, including remote environment.Ideally, you'll also have:Two-year Associate's Degree in relevant field, such as electrician, instrumentation & controls, constructionExposure to National Electrical Code (NFPA 70/NEC)Experience in semiconductor or similar industrial facilitiesAdditional Details:This is a hybrid position and may require periodic travel to client sitesPreference to candidates located in Jacobs home office locations; such as Portland Hillsboro, Corvallis OR; Tempe AZ; Pittsburgh PA.Site work will require field mobility including walking for surveys, stairs, access platforms, protective wear, etc.Must pass background check, drug screening and be fully authorized to work in the U.S.
